def delete_issues_from_cache_that_are_not_in_server issue_data_hash:, path:
  # The gotcha with deleted issues is that they just stop being returned in queries
  # and we have no way to know that they should be removed from our local cache.
  # With the new approach, we ask for every issue that Jira knows about (within
  # the parameters of the query) and then delete anything that's in our local cache
  # but wasn't returned.
  @file_system.foreach path do |file|
    next if file.start_with? '.'
    raise "Unexpected filename in #{path}: #{file}" unless file =~ /^(\w+-\d+)-\d+\.json$/

    key = $1
    next if issue_data_hash[key] # Still in Jira

    file_to_delete = File.join(path, file)
    log "  Issue #{key} appears to have been deleted from Jira. Removing local copy", both: true
    file_system.unlink file_to_delete
  end
end

def make_jql filter_id:, today: Date.today
  segments = []
  segments << "filter=#{filter_id}"

  start_date = @download_config.start_date today: today

  if start_date
    @download_date_range = start_date..today.to_date
    @start_date_in_query = @download_date_range.begin

    # Catch-all to pick up anything that's been around since before the range started but hasn't
    # had an update during the range.
    catch_all = '((status changed OR Sprint is not EMPTY) AND statusCategory != Done)'

    # Pick up any issues that had a status change in the range
    start_date_text = @start_date_in_query.strftime '%Y-%m-%d'
    # find_in_range = %((status changed DURING ("#{start_date_text} 00:00","#{end_date_text} 23:59")))
    find_in_range = %(updated >= "#{start_date_text} 00:00")

    segments << "(#{find_in_range} OR #{catch_all})"
  end

  segments.join ' AND '
end
